Don't go VRBO! Advocate, The, July 5, 2005 The huge Web site VRBO.com (Vacation Rentals by Owner) says it lists over 37,000 vacation rentals worldwide--but evidently no gay ones. The Out Traveler was informed in April that a listing for rentals at the gay-owned St. Philip Apartments in New Orleans had been removed because the wording "Gay/Lesbian Family Friendly" was used in the online description. In an e-mail, VRBO.com's owner, David Clouse, wrote, "I believe that it is wrong to be forced to promote an activity which is totally outside my belief system--in this case, sexual activity, hetero or homo, outside of the definition of a traditional marriage union." The gay online lodging directory PurpleRoofs.com refuses any VRBO.com-linked listings. We also suggest to stay away from VRBO.com"
